Latest Patents
Among his latest patents is the invention of an Fe-based amorphous alloy ribbon, which is designed to reduce iron loss and improve productivity. This innovative ribbon operates effectively under a magnetic flux density of 1.45 T. The patent details a unique production method that includes continuous linear laser irradiation marks on the ribbon's surface. These marks are strategically placed in a direction orthogonal to the casting direction, creating a surface with specific unevenness. The height difference and width of these marks are meticulously calculated to optimize the ribbon's performance.
